Honorable Mentions

Tip: Keep your attention on the main thread.Help reference icon

While not necessarily the most boring cities in Texas, these towns also deserve a mention:

  • San Angelo: Known for its rodeo culture and its proximity to the Fort Concho National Historic Landmark, San Angelo offers a unique blend of history and Western charm. However, some visitors find the city a bit sleepy.

  • Abilene: Home to Abilene Christian University, Abilene is a college town with a historic downtown district. While it has its attractions, the city's overall vibe can be a bit subdued.
